The drone is part of the digital ecosystem created by Rosatom

#ARCTIC. #SIBERIA. THIS IS TAIMYR. The UAV-based ice reconnaissance complex has been successfully tested in the Arctic. The uniqueness of the tests is that the drone took off and landed on the platform for helicopters of a drifting nuclear-powered icebreaker. This was reported in the Northern Sea Route (NSR) Directorate.

The experts assessed the operation of the aircraft on-board systems, geolocation, ice conditions images transmission.

Maxim Kulinko, deputy director of the Northern Sea Route Directorate of Rosatom State Corporation, told TASS that the complex is one of the elements of the NSR digital ecosystem, which the company is creating. In addition to the drone, it will include a unified platform for digital services, a data fund and onboard measuring systems.

The digital ecosystem will improve the navigation safety, as well as the economic efficiency of maritime transportation in the Arctic. It is planned that the system will be created in 2024, and in 2025 it will be fully put into operation.
